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7801319615 63474 778351
665 34224853
665 34224853
430 203625 12281648 766
All about undefined
Interested in learning more?
665 34224853
430 203625 12281648 766
See more
1019 219412460
423385360 0248484236 1985506811
See more
4213190 024903 508
53570 0453340 14898583
See more